摘要
Mesoporous titania nanotubes with tunable dimension have been fabricated within the pores of alumina membranes by a simple sol-gel templating method. The 3D network structures of these mesoporous nanotubes (see figure) can provide both electron pathway and lithium ion pathway which benefit their applications in a high rate rechargeable lithium battery.
